WebJul 1, 2004 · The BLAST server at the National Center for Biotechnology Information (NCBI) now has a diverse set of features that can add power to your BLAST searching. The BLAST homepage ( http://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/BLAST/) lists the varieties of BLAST searches by type: Nucleotide, Protein, Translated and Genomes.
